JOB PURPOSE:

As Amnesty International's expert on Ukraine and conflict, in the Eastern Europe and Central Asia Regional Office, lead on the development and implementation of overarching research and campaigning strategies to deliver impact in relation to agreed priorities, providing research expertise and management, political judgment, sound communication, and analytical and representational skills.

MAIN R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Lead on the development and implementation of research and campaign strategies to deliver impact on agreed priorities for countries within Eastern Europe and Central Asia with a strong focus on Ukraine
  • Monitor, research, investigate and analyse human rights developments in a timely, accurate, impartial way and be the expert in the region
  • Organise and take part in field missions, gathering data and preparing assessments and briefings
  • Be an ambassador for Amnesty International in the field, particularly with regards to Ukraine, and with external parties such as government officials, civil society organisations, the media and the public
  • Write and deliver high quality reports and presentations
  • Help manage and develop the team including consultants and volunteers and recruitment
  • Contribute to the effective maintenance of our information management system
  • Contribute to strategies and plans for our region with regards to research and campaigns

ABOUT US:

Amnesty International is a global movement of more than 10 million people who campaign for a world where human rights are enjoyed by all. We reach almost every country in the world. Our aim is simple: an end to human rights abuses. Independent, international and influential, we campaign for justice, fairness, freedom and truth wherever they're denied. And whether we're applying pressure through powerful research or direct lobbying, mass demonstrations or online campaigning, we're all inspired by hope for a better world. One where human rights are respected and protected by everyone, everywhere.
